我目前有一个Jenkins管道项目,通过Refspec
监听新标签的创建但是,这不会监听在分支上推送的正常提交。
我尝试使用此RefSpec +refs/tags/*:refs/remotes/origin/tags/* +refs/heads/*:refs/remotes/origin/*
并将分支说明符设置为**
,然后尝试**/tags/*
和**/heads/*
,但正常提交不会触发构建。如果我使用两个单独的管道,我可以让它们正确地单独工作(一个只触发提交而另一个只针对新标签)。
我正在使用GitHub插件,并为管道启用了GitHub hook trigger for GITScm polling
,并在GitHub上为Jenkins设置了webhook。我也在使用SCM方法的Jenkins文件。
是否可以使用单个管道来触发新标记和正常提交的构建?
由于